Title: Supply Chain Planning Analyst II Location: Charlotte, NC Duration: 6-Months Contract (Can convert to FTE) Shift Hours: 7:30AM - 5PM (Mon -Fri) Note: Remote Job, but training will take place at the Charlotte location JOB DESCRIPTION The Supply Chain Planning Analyst is responsible for managing and optimizing end-to-end supply chain operations—from procurement to distribution. The role focuses on demand forecasting, inventory management, and process improvement to ensure efficiency, cost reduction, and product availability. Key Duties: Inventory & Demand Planning: • Analyze sales data, forecast demand, and maintain optimal stock levels across warehouses. Supply Chain Optimization: • Identify and implement improvements to reduce costs, lead times, and inefficiencies. Distribution Coordination: • Align delivery schedules and logistics operations to ensure timely order fulfillment. Data Analysis & Reporting: • Use analytical tools to track KPIs, assess performance, and present actionable insights. Vendor & Stakeholder Management: • Collaborate with suppliers, logistics partners, and internal teams to align supply chain goals. Process & Risk Management: • Drive continuous improvement initiatives and develop contingency plans for potential disruptions. Qualifications: •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ain, Business, or related field. • 2–4 years of supply chain or logistics experience. • Strong analytical, communication, and problem-solving skills. • Proficiency with Excel, ERP systems (SAP/Oracle), and supply chain software. • Preferred: APICS certification, experience with Tableau/Power BI, and familiarity with Lean or Six Sigma. • Work Environment: • Primarily office-based with occasional visits to warehouses or production sites; requires teamwork and cross-department collaboration.
